Last lap overtake secures Lecuona’s best MotoGP result in dry conditions
Iker Lecuona secured his first back-to-back top ten MotoGP finishes courtesy of late race overtakes on Francesco Bagnaia, Joan Mir and Alex Marquez at Silverstone. It’s the Tech 3 KTM rider’s second best finish in the premier class after taking sixth in the AustrianGP - while also his best result in the dry. Aside from race winner Fabio Quartararo, Ducati’s Jack Miller and Binder, there was no rider on track with better pace than Lecuona during the final five laps. ...
